Excellent stuff. Magnetism is one of those scents that draws you in closer. Whenever I wear this, I keep sniffing around because something smells so wonderful, only to remember it's ME! It's sexy and playful, yet refined and classy at the same time. According to Sephora, the notes are as follows: "Leafy Greens, Basil, Freesia, Black Currant, Plumberry, Jasmine, Immortelle, Muguet, Blond Woods, Iris, Almond Blossom, Amber, Musk, Cashmere Vanilla, Sandalwood". It starts of on a slightly sweet/green note, but then quickly warms up to this beautiful sweet scent that just gets better with time. It has great sillage and lasting power, too! The bottle is interesting, but it suits the scent very well. It's on the pricey side, but I just got the gift set (1.7 oz. EDP, lotion, and shower gel) for $60 at Macy's. I would recommend this as a 'going out' scent.

Magnetism is sexy but subtle; modern, complex, a great fall scent. It's a little like Pink Sugar, but much sexier and more mature. There's a bit of a peppery aroma that accompanies the topnotes, then it dries down to cotton candy vanilla sex appeal. And for anyone who is interested, men love this. INGREDIENTS: Leafy greens, basil, freesia, black currant, plumberry, jasmine, immortelle, lily of the valley, blond woods, iris, almond blossom, amber, musk, cashmere vanilla, sandalwood

I remember going around the perfume shop, looking for something fruity. The wonderful French man working the counter said he did not like this one, it was too fruity. But I bought it anyways, and it grew on me. This is now my signature fragrance.
On initial spray the green leaf smell is pretty strong, but it folds into a slightly woodsy, slightly citrusy scent. Then sweet fruit tinges over warm vanilla with a patcholi base. At times, it almost seems to smell slightly praline with caramel, but this is only when you really concentrate and really inhale.
It takes a while for the green scent to fade, but once it is over it is a lightly heavy fragrance of intrigue, confidence, and utter sensuality.
The bottle is kind of obnoxious with its narrow base, so I like to keep it propped up against something. It is super pretty fuschia with elegant angles, so I do not mind keeping it on my shelf.
